A LOCAL builders’ merchant are taking part in a community initiative that will see 100 good deeds carried out over the next few months.

MKM Building Supplies, on Twibell Street – who have sponsored Barnsley Hospice’s ‘loose change box appeal’ for the last two years – are taking part in a ‘100 Good Deeds’ campaign to celebrate the opening of its 100th branch nationwide.

The Barnsley branch chose to support Barnsley Hospice for its good deed.

Mark Winstanley, branch director at MKM Barnsley, said: “We’ve sponsored the hospice’s loose change appeal for the last two years. We are very proud to be part of MKM’s ‘100 Good Deeds’ campaign and we hope to continue supporting the hospice and making a difference.

“We do other things throughout the year, we often do breakfast mornings to raise funds for the hospice, and other fundraising events where we can. It’s all for a brilliant cause.”
